Rashomon (1950)
羅生門
8.8 (1152 ratings) director: Akira Kurosawa actor: Toshirō Mifune / Machiko Kyō
other title: 라쇼몽 / 羅生門
Brimming with action while incisively examining the nature of truth, "Rashomon" is perhaps the finest film ever to investigate the philosophy of justice. Through an ingenious use of camera and flashbacks, Kurosawa reveals the complexities of human nature as four people recount different versions of the story of a man's murder and the rape of his wife.
The Wave (2008)
Die Welle
8.5 (1290 ratings) director: 丹尼斯·甘塞尔 actor: 于尔根·福格尔 / 弗雷德里克·劳
other title: 浪潮 / Die Welle
A school teacher discusses types of government with his class. His students find it too boring to repeatedly go over national socialism and believe that dictatorship cannot be established in modern Germany. He starts an experiment to show how easily the masses can become manipulated.
The Shawshank Redemption (1994)
The Shawshank Redemption
9.4 (2960 ratings) director: 弗兰克·德拉邦特 actor: 蒂姆·罗宾斯 / 摩根·弗里曼
other title: 肖申克的救赎 / 月黑高飞(港)
Imprisoned in the 1940s for the double murder of his wife and her lover, upstanding banker Andy Dufresne begins a new life at the Shawshank prison, where he puts his accounting skills to work for an amoral warden. During his long stretch in prison, Dufresne comes to be admired by the other inmates -- including an older prisoner named Red -- for his integrity and unquenchable sense of hope.
One Flew Over the Cuckoo's Nest (1975)
One Flew Over the Cuckoo's Nest
8.9 (1377 ratings) director: Miloš Forman actor: Jack Nicholson / Danny DeVito
other title: 飞越疯人院 / 飞越杜鹃窝(台)
A petty criminal fakes insanity to serve his sentence in a mental ward rather than prison. He soon finds himself as a leader to the other patients—and an enemy to the cruel, domineering nurse who runs the ward.
12 Angry Men (1957)
12 Angry Men
9.5 (1559 ratings) director: 西德尼·吕美特 actor: 亨利·方达 / 马丁·巴尔萨姆
other title: 十二怒汉 / 12怒汉
The defense and the prosecution have rested and the jury is filing into the jury room to decide if a young Spanish-American is guilty or innocent of murdering his father. What begins as an open and shut case soon becomes a mini-drama of each of the jurors' prejudices and preconceptions about the trial, the accused, and each other.
